Quote:
Originally Posted by Cap.Palla
S ! Guys ...
I played my first GWX mission and i noticed that night is too dark....i really can't see any ships . Is a graphic card problem? Or should i install some mod ?

Well something could be done on a next Update about that bro, but depending on the season the ocean , nights can be more or less darken...

Example, if you started the normal date in the campaign career, the
starting month is October mate, so it's close to winter, your patrols will
be in North Atlantic Ocean, and Atlantic in general, nights are pretty dark by that time of the year in Atlantic bro, and depending if some other situations, like Moonlight, weather if it's good or bad, thats was made to get really Ocean enviorment....

But you all ways can use your monitor Gama controls to light it up a bit when you play GWX...
